    Palazzo Alfieri in Asti, Italy, is a significant cultural landmark dedicated to the famous Italian poet and dramatist Vittorio Alfieri. The museum, housed in the poet's birthplace, offers visitors an insight into Alfieri's life and work. The palazzo itself is an impressive example of Baroque architecture, with well-preserved period furnishings and decor that transport visitors back to the 18th century.

    The museum's exhibits include Alfieri's personal belongings, manuscripts, and a collection of his works.
